It is recommended to purchase an electric tool from a manufacturer that has a good track record. This means that you can be confident that the product is durable and can be able to withstand the pressure of daily usage. The manufacturer's customer service is likely to be quick and efficient.

Professional tradespeople are known to be fiercely loyal to their favorite brands however, they tend to agree that most power tools fall into an overall category. Metalworkers prefer Milwaukee while carpenters choose DeWalt. You should also check out the power tool kits that your local box stores carry. Try them out and see which ones feel right in your hand.

Take note of whether the charger and battery of the power tool are included in the cost. This can save you money if you don't intend to purchase an additional battery and charger every time you need to make use of the tool. Additionally, many major brands have compatible cordless systems that allow users to switch between tools on the same voltage. This allows you to maximize your budget and organize your tools.

Make sure that the devices are properly plugged-in and are not put in "standby" or switched off. Unplugging them and leaving them on could result in electrocution, fires and injuries. Check the plugs of your power tools prior to and after use to prevent accidents. Keep your workspace neat and tidy. A messy workspace with cords that are tangled is a recipe for disaster.

Also, ensure that you wear appropriate personal protective equipment (PPE) when working with power tools. This includes safety goggles, face masks, earplugs, hard hats, and work gloves. Avoid wearing loose clothing since it could hinder your ability to use the tool, or catch on moving parts.

You should also stay clear of using power tools if you are drunk or high on drugs, if you feel tired, ill or distracted. These conditions can reduce your reaction time and impair your judgment, which could lead to dangerous mistakes.
